Highlights
Are people in Bedford older or younger than people in Whitestown?
- The Median Age in Bedford is 13.2 years older than in Whitestown.

Are housing costs cheaper in Bedford or Whitestown?
- Bedford housing costs are 50.0% less expensive than Whitestown hous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Bedford or Whitestown?
- The average commute for residents of Bedford is 4.0 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Whitestown.

Things to do in Whitestown?
Living in Whitestown, IN is a truly unique experience. The town is small enough to feel like a tight-knit community but also offers plenty of amenities for those looking for adventure and exploration. Residents here enjoy being close to the outdoors with access to fishing, hiking, boating, camping, and other activities in nearby forests and state parks as well as many golf courses. There are also plenty of local shops and restaurants for those who prefer an urban atmosphere. No matter what your interests or lifestyle may be, you’ll find plenty of options available in Whitestown.
